Allow us to introduce ourselves

We are the Cascade Chordsmen, the performing chorus of the Elyria Chapter of the Society for the Preservation and Encouragement of Barbershop Quartet Singing in America, Inc. (SPEBSQSA, Inc.) Organized in 1945, our chorus prides itself in its unique style of musical entertainment, characterized by a repertoire of songs ranging from traditional barbershop classics to contemporary arrangements. We perform both as a full chorus and in quartets, for fun and fund raising, singing for private, civic and charitable organizations in the Northern Ohio area. Our chorus consists of men of various occupations from Elyria, Cleveland, Sandusky, Norwalk, Ashland, and surrounding areas.

The Cascade Chordsmen compete annually in division and district contests, in the Johnny Appleseed District (covering Ohio, Western Pennsylvania, and most of West Virginia and some of Kentucky). We proudly host an annual show each spring on the Saturday before Mother's Day, held at the Elyria High School auditorium in Elyria, Ohio.

 

SPEBSQSA, Inc., The Barbershop Harmony Society

The Society is truly an international singing organization. We have over 800 chapters throughout the United States, Canada, Scandinavia, England, and Japan. This comprises the largest fraternity of singers in the world with over 34,000 members ... and is still growing! The international headquarters is located in Kenosha, Wisconsin. Each year they sponsor a convention where championship choruses and quartets compete for international titles. The goal of the Society is to promote and perpetuate this true American art form by bringing together male voices from all walks of life in four-part harmony.
